GB/T 4615-2013
ActivePoly(vinyl chloride) - Determination of residual vinyl chloride monomer gas-chromatographic method
聚氯乙烯 残留氯乙烯单体的测定 气相色谱法
Application Summary AI generated
This standard specifies a gas-chromatographic method for determining the amount of residual vinyl chloride monomer (VCM) in poly(vinyl chloride) (PVC) resins and compounds. It is applied in the quality control and safety testing of PVC materials used in products like pipes, packaging, and medical devices, where low VCM levels are critical to meet health and regulatory limits. The method is used by manufacturers, testing laboratories, and regulatory bodies to ensure compliance with maximum residual monomer thresholds.
